数字货币硬件钱包实现原理详解
引言
随着数字货币的普及,安全性问题日益突出。用户如何安全地存储和管理自己的数字资产已成为一个重要的课题。硬件钱包作为一种新兴的数字货币存储解决方案,以其高安全性和便捷性逐渐受到大众的喜爱。本文将深入探讨数字货币硬件钱包的实现原理及其相关概念,帮助用户更好地理解这一工具的运作方式。
数字货币概述
数字货币是指采取电子形式存在的货币,最著名的代表便是比特币(Bitcoin)。区别于传统货币,数字货币不需借助中央机构的支持,利用区块链技术实现去中心化的交易方式。数字货币的特点包括:透明性、不可篡改性和去中心化。但这些优点的同时,也带来了盗币、丢失等安全隐患。
硬件钱包的定义及作用
硬件钱包是一种专门用于存储数字货币私钥的物理设备。与普通软件钱包(如手机应用、电脑软件)相比,硬件钱包提供了更高级别的安全防护。硬件钱包的主要作用在于安全存储用户的私钥,即使在连接互联网的情况下,它也能有效隔离数字资产与潜在的网络攻击者。硬件钱包的设计通常包括多个层次的安全机制,如安全元件、密码保护,以及物理防篡改等,以确保私钥的安全性。
硬件钱包的工作原理
硬件钱包的核心原理在于生成、存储和使用私钥,其工作流程可以分为以下几个步骤:
1. **私钥的生成**:硬件钱包在首次使用时,会随机生成用户的私钥,并将其存储在设备的安全存储区域。由于这一过程完全在硬件设备内部完成,私钥不会暴露于联网环境,有效降低了被黑客窃取的风险。 2. **交易签名**:在进行数字货币交易时,硬件钱包需要对交易进行签名。用户在连接设备后,会通过硬件钱包的界面输入交易信息(如金额、接收地址等),设备随后自动计算出签名并将签名结果返回给用户的应用程序,而私钥依然不被泄露。 3. **发送交易**:签名完成后,用户的应用程序会将已经签名的信息发送至区块链网络中待确认。整个过程中,用户无需暴露私钥,确保了资产的安全。 4. **备份和恢复**:在首次设置硬件钱包时,用户会获得一组助记词(种子词),这些助记词可以用于备份和恢复钱包,确保在设备丢失或损坏时,用户依然能够找回自己的资产。硬件钱包的安全性
硬件钱包的安全性主要来源于多个方面的设计:
- **隔离安全**:硬件钱包与网络是物理隔离的,用户的私钥长期保留在设备内部,不会与其他联网设备直接接触。这种设计有效保护了私钥即使在网络上发生攻击时也不被泄露。 - **安全元件**:许多高端硬件钱包内部集成了安全元件,这是一种专门设计用来抵御物理攻击的芯片,其能在面临攻击时自我销毁,从而确保私钥安全。 - **多重验证**:硬件钱包通常设定有多个身份验证,比如PIN码、指纹识别等,增加了恶意用户访问钱包的难度。 - **定期更新**:许多硬件钱包制造商会定期发布固件更新,以修复已知漏洞并增强安全性。这不仅确保了钱包的稳定性,还能够有效抵御最新的网络攻击。常见问题解答
1. 硬件钱包与其他钱包的主要区别是什么?
硬件钱包与软件钱包相比,其最大的优势在于安全性。软件钱包既包括桌面钱包,也包括手机钱包,这些钱包都是在线的,私钥可能暴露在黑客的攻击中。然而,硬件钱包因其内置的安全元件与物理隔离设计,使得私钥几乎不可能被盗取。
此外,硬件钱包通常说来更加便携,用户可随身携带,而软件钱包则同样依赖于设备的安全性,若设备受病毒感染,用户的数字资产将面临巨大风险。不论是安全性还是使用体验,硬件钱包均优于其他类型的钱包。
2. 使用硬件钱包的成本和效益如何计算?
尽管硬件钱包会在初期需要一定的投资(通常在几十到几百美元不等),但其安全保障所提供的长期效益是毋庸置疑的。首先,硬件钱包可以有效防止黑客攻击,用户的数字资产得以安然无恙,省去因被盗而导致的巨大财务损失。
其次,许多硬件钱包配备便捷的用户界面,提升了交易的效率和便捷性。用户不再需要担心操作失误引发的资金损失。长远来看,安全性和使用便利性可以带来显著的投资回报。
3. 如何选择合适的硬件钱包?
选购硬件钱包时,应考虑几个重要因素。首先是安全性,选择市场上信誉良好、拥有多重安全措施的硬件钱包非常重要。其次,兼容性也需考虑,确保所选的硬件钱包可支持您所需使用的钱包,如果您拥有多种数字资产,就更应关注其对各类加密货币的支持程度。
另外,用户体验也是选择的重要标准,易用的界面能够帮助新手用户快速上手,更好地管理和使用自己的数字资产。最后,价格也是不可忽视的因素,但切忌盲目追求低价,安全才是最根本的需求。
4. 硬件钱包的备份和恢复流程是什么?
备份和恢复硬件钱包是用户使用过程中非常重要的一环,确保在钱包设备丢失或损坏后,可以通过助记词找回资产。用户在硬件钱包初始化时,会被要求书写助记词,以便在需要时使用(通常为12个、18个或24个随机单词组合)。
在恢复过程中,用户需重新初始化设备并选择“恢复钱包”选项,然后输入之前记录下来的助记词。根据助记词,硬件钱包能够生成和恢复相应的私钥,从而访问用户的数字货币资产。
因此,确保妥善存放助记词特别重要,切忌轻易透露给他人或保存在不安全的地方。
结语
数字货币硬件钱包作为一种切实有效的数字资产存储方式,以其优越的安全性和便捷性为越来越多的用户所接受。了解其基本原理和运作机制,不仅有助于用户更安全地管理数字资产,也有助于提高对数字货币市场的整体认知。通过合理选用硬件钱包,用户能够更好地保护自己的投资,并享受快速增长的数字货币市场带来的红利。